Repointing services involve the careful removal and replacement of the mortar that binds bricks or stones in a building’s exterior walls. Over time, mortar can deteriorate due to exposure to weather, temperature changes, and general aging, leading to crumbling or cracked joints. Skilled contractors carefully chip out the old mortar without damaging the surrounding bricks and then fill the gaps with fresh mortar. This process not only restores the appearance of the property but also helps maintain its structural integrity, preventing further damage caused by water infiltration or shifting masonry.

Many common problems can signal the need for repointing work. Cracks or gaps in the mortar joints, crumbling or powdery mortar, and areas where bricks or stones are loose or shifting are signs that the mortar is failing. Water leaks around the exterior walls, especially after heavy rain, can also indicate that the mortar is no longer effectively sealing the structure. Addressing these issues early with professional repointing can prevent more costly repairs down the line, such as replacing entire sections of brickwork or dealing with foundational issues caused by water damage.

Repointing is often necessary for a variety of property types, particularly older homes and historic buildings that feature traditional brick or stone exteriors. It is also common in commercial properties, townhouses, and period-style homes that have retained their original masonry. Properties located in areas with harsh weather conditions, such as Youngstown, OH, where freeze-thaw cycles are frequent, are especially vulnerable to mortar deterioration. The overview below groups typical Repointing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Youngstown, OH.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Repointing minor cracks or damaged mortar typically costs between $250 and $600 for many smaller jobs. Most routine repairs fall within this range, depending on the extent of the work needed.

Moderate Projects - Repointing larger sections of brickwork or multiple areas usually ranges from $600 to $2,000. These projects are common and often involve several hours of work by local contractors.

Full Wall Repointing - Completely restoring a brick wall can cost between $2,000 and $5,000, especially for larger or more complex structures. Fewer projects reach the highest tiers, which are reserved for extensive or intricate repointing jobs.

Complete Repointing or Restoration - Entire building facades or historic restorations can exceed $5,000, depending on size and detail. Such projects are less frequent and often involve specialized craftsmanship by experienced service providers.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
